Guy de Maupassant (5 August 1850 – 6 July 1893), full name - Henri René Albert Guy de Maupassant was a French writer and novelist, author of many famous novels and stories. Guy de Maupassant was born in the castle de Miromesnil near Dieppe. His father - Gustave de Maupassant - who belonged to the aristocratic old Lorraine, settled in Normandy, married Laura le Poitevin. The first story of Maupassant was released in 1880 with tales of Zola, Alexis, Ceara, Ennika and Huysmans, in the collection «Les soirées de Médan».
